Dating Confidence Reset
You don’t have to be upbeat all the time to date well. Start by clarifying what you actually want from Mingle2: short chats, casual dates, or something long-term. Write one or two clear goals and check them before you message someone—this keeps you focused and saves energy.
Set realistic expectations. Treat early conversations as information-gathering, not final verdicts. Most first messages don’t turn into relationships, and that’s normal. When you expect a few dead-ends, the ones that do click feel calmer and clearer.
Pace conversations intentionally. Ask two good questions and share one real detail about yourself before moving to plans. If replies are slow or one-word, slow your pace too. If someone shows curiosity and consistency, you can step up to a phone call or a meet-up. Matching pace preserves dignity and reduces message fatigue.
Notice small progress. Celebrate a thoughtful reply, a shared laugh, or a message that keeps going beyond surface topics. Tracking these tiny wins helps you feel momentum without chasing a big outcome.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Scan profiles for specific signals—shared interests, similar communication styles, or clear intent—and prioritize people who match your goals and boundaries. It’s better to message fewer people with purpose than to treat profiles like a numbers game.
Keep emotional steadiness. Take breaks when scrolling or messaging feels draining. Use simple resets: a walk, a hobby, or limiting browsing time. When you return, review your goals and drop conversations that repeatedly leave you unsure or exhausted.
These steps protect your time and self-respect while keeping you open to good connections. Small, intentional habits on Mingle2 will help you feel steadier, more confident, and clearer about what comes next.
